I will praise th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: marvellous are thy works; and that my soul knoweth right well.
King James Version

Meaning

David is praying here, marveling at how God created each person with intricate care and intention. The phrase "fearfully and wonderfully made" means both awe-inspiring complexity and tender craftsmanship. David isn't just talking about physical bodies—he's recognizing that every aspect of who we are, from personality to fingerprints, is God's deliberate masterpiece.
